// Implementation for ns3 Application base class.
// George F. Riley, Georgia Tech, Fall 2006
#include "application.h"
#include "ns3/node.h"
#include "ns3/nstime.h"
#include "ns3/random-variable.h"
#include "ns3/simulator.h"
using namespace std;
namespace ns3 {
// Application Methods
// \brief Application Constructor
Application::Application(Ptr<Node> n)
: m_node (n)
{
m_node->AddApplication (this);
}
// \brief Application Destructor
Application::~Application()
{}
void
Application::DoDispose (void)
{
m_node = 0;
Simulator::Cancel(m_startEvent);
Simulator::Cancel(m_stopEvent);
}
void Application::Start(const Time& startTime)
{
ScheduleStart (startTime);
}
void Application::Start(const RandomVariable& startVar)
{
RandomVariable *v = startVar.Copy ();
ScheduleStart (Seconds (v->GetValue ()));
delete v;
}
void Application::Stop(const Time& stopTime)
{
ScheduleStop (stopTime);
}
void Application::Stop(const RandomVariable& stopVar)
{
RandomVariable *v = stopVar.Copy ();
ScheduleStop (Seconds (v->GetValue ()));
delete v;
}
Ptr<Node> Application::GetNode() const
{
return m_node;
}
// Protected methods
// StartApp and StopApp will likely be overridden by application subclasses
void Application::StartApplication()
{ // Provide null functionality in case subclass is not interested
}
void Application::StopApplication()
{ // Provide null functionality in case subclass is not interested
}
// Private helpers
void Application::ScheduleStart (const Time &startTime)
{
m_startEvent = Simulator::Schedule(startTime -
Simulator::Now(),
&Application::StartApplication, this);
}
void Application::ScheduleStop (const Time &stopTime)
{
m_stopEvent = Simulator::Schedule(stopTime -
Simulator::Now(),
&Application::StopApplication, this);
}
} //namespace ns3
